Output dbf90bf885dbd096499ece01bafe7a7d77e8330c93f0024eb6d39de63cf2d355:18

value
1542988615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d18a362832df9f3a1d42b58938476a95cf409ae OP_EQUAL
address
3Mr4mqCvekYmZWREXZLgBG6SjqW6dyxxe4
transaction
dbf90bf885dbd096499ece01bafe7a7d77e8330c93f0024eb6d39de63cf2d355
spent
true